This herb, in Latin … WebIf your plant is in a pot. The most precise way to decide whether your Mexican Bush Sage needs water is to plunge your finger into the soil. If you notice that the first two to three inches of soil have become dry, it is time to add some water. If you grow your Mexican Bush Sage outdoors in the ground, you can use a similar method to test the soil.
